Analysis

In 2025, unemployment rates of adults, by educational attainment, age group in Korea stood at 4.49 Percentage of labour force in the same subgroup.

The figure is up 4.5% on the previous year and down 17.2% over ten years.

Over the whole period, unemployment rates of adults, by educational attainment, age group in Korea peaked at 7.62 Percentage of labour force in the same subgroup in 1998 and was at its lowest, 2.18 Percentage of labour force in the same subgroup, in 1995.

This dataset contains data on unemployment rates by educational attainment level, age group and gender. The default table displays 2025 data (or the latest available year) on the unemployment rates of 25-64 year-olds with below upper secondary, upper secondary or post-secondary non-tertiary, or tertiary attainment. The selection can be changed to display data by more detailed educational attainment level, by programme orientation, by gender and by age group. Filter the time period to display historical data.
